From what I understand, most front panel controlls can be controlled through midi. I think all the controlls that send midi can also be controlled by midi. The user manual lists all the midi CC messages sent by the LP and their range on p. 44-45. In OS 2.0 the mod wheel and filter cutoff also are able to transmitt 14-bit midi and aolso recieves 14-bit. This is in the 2.0 users manual addendum on p.3
Controlling some parameter through a midi controller will cause you to lose Moog's proprietary RAC (real analog control). In the Stage Edition,
RAC provides responsive analog control for the Osc 1 & 2, Filter Cutoff, Filter Resonance, EG Amount, Overload and Filter EG Sustain parameters. I think the tribute has more parameters that get the RAC treatment, but I do not know which.
I am going with a midi foot controller to augment the controll surface offered from the LP. I want to be able to change mod sources or destrinations without paging through all 6, change presets, or if I want to change 2 parameters in one section at the same time.
